Output 2ecfcecf3fb8936aca86f1162783c83e253c03c0c4f693359f387ee1de2ec4c0:5

value
558754003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d33d7eef60b54f0e4c87de77b54908055c9f8d47 OP_EQUAL
address
3LwxAprR4wk2hPZVkaYXx44uLeZkZS981D
transaction
2ecfcecf3fb8936aca86f1162783c83e253c03c0c4f693359f387ee1de2ec4c0
confirmations
441987
spent
true